Ensuring Food Safety: The Importance Of Food Contamination Testing

food contamination testing is a critical aspect of food safety measures that help to protect consumers from potentially harmful illnesses caused by consuming contaminated products. With the increasing complexity of global food supply chains and the rise of foodborne illnesses, ensuring the safety of the food we eat has never been more important. In this article, we will explore the significance of food contamination testing and how it plays a crucial role in safeguarding public health.

Food contamination can occur at any stage of the food production process, from farm to fork. Contaminants such as bacteria, viruses, parasites, chemicals, and foreign objects can find their way into food products, posing serious health risks to consumers. Foodborne illnesses can range from mild gastrointestinal discomfort to more severe conditions such as food poisoning, botulism, and even death in extreme cases.

To prevent such scenarios, food manufacturers, retailers, and regulatory bodies rely on food contamination testing to identify and eliminate potential sources of contamination before they reach consumers. This involves the analysis of food samples for various contaminants using specialized testing methods and equipment. These tests can detect a wide range of contaminants, including pathogens like Salmonella, E. coli, and Listeria, as well as chemical residues, allergens, and foreign objects.

There are several methods of food contamination testing available, each with its own advantages and limitations. Microbiological testing, for example, involves the analysis of food samples for the presence of harmful bacteria, yeasts, and molds. This type of testing is commonly used to detect pathogens in raw and processed foods, as well as to monitor hygiene practices in food production facilities.

Chemical testing, on the other hand, focuses on identifying residues of pesticides, heavy metals, additives, and other harmful chemicals in food products. This type of testing is essential for ensuring compliance with legal limits and safety standards, especially in highly regulated industries such as agriculture and food processing. By screening for chemical contaminants, food businesses can mitigate the risks of exposure to toxic substances and protect consumer health.

With the advancement of technology, food contamination testing has become more accurate, efficient, and accessible than ever before. Modern testing methods such as DNA sequencing, chromatography, and mass spectrometry allow for rapid detection and identification of contaminants at trace levels. These tools enable food businesses to make informed decisions about food safety and quality assurance, ensuring that only safe and compliant products reach the market.
